Ingredients
Scale
Chicken
- 1 pound chicken breasts (boneless, skinless)
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 2 tablespoons unsalted butter, cut into small pieces
Vegetables
- 1 pound fresh green beans, trimmed
- 1.5 pounds red or yellow potatoes, quartered
Seasonings & Liquids
- 1/2 cup chicken broth
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1 teaspoon onion powder
- 1/2 teaspoon paprika
- 1/2 teaspoon dried thyme
Instructions
- Prepare the Vegetables: Begin by washing and preparing the green beans and potatoes. Trim the ends off the green beans and quarter the potatoes. Place them at the bottom of your slow cooker to form a bed for the chicken.
- Prepare the Chicken: Rinse the chicken breasts under cold water and pat them dry with a paper towel. Layer the chicken breasts on top of the vegetables in the slow cooker.
- Make the Seasoning Mix: In a small bowl, combine the salt, black pepper, garlic powder, onion powder, paprika, and dried thyme, mixing well to create a flavorful seasoning blend.
- Season the Chicken: Pour the olive oil over the chicken breasts and rub the seasoning mixture onto the chicken to ensure each piece is evenly coated with flavor.
- Add Liquids: Pour the chicken broth gently over the chicken, potatoes, and green beans to add moisture and enhance cooking.
- Add Butter: Distribute the butter pieces evenly across the top of the chicken and vegetables to enrich the dish with a buttery finish.
- Cook Slowly: Cover the slow cooker with its lid and cook on low setting for 7 to 8 hours or on high for 4 to 5 hours, until the chicken is tender and the potatoes are fully cooked.
- Check Doneness: Once cooking time is complete, use a fork to check the tenderness of the chicken and potatoes. Adjust seasoning with additional salt or pepper if desired.
- Serve: Serve the seasoned chicken with the green beans and potatoes, spooning some of the flavorful juices from the bottom of the slow cooker over the top.
Notes
- For a quicker option, cook on high for 4 to 5 hours instead of low for 7 to 8 hours.
- You can substitute green beans with other vegetables like carrots or zucchini based on preference.
- Adjust seasoning levels to taste before serving for enhanced flavor.
- Leftovers can be refrigerated and reheated within 3 days for easy meals.
